Cyber and Privacy Risks (2024)

Internet and networked technologies have changed many aspects of how business operates. The ability to readily store and share data across interconnected networks has created new efficiencies in sales and marketing, data access and retrieval, and vendor relations and interaction.

Yet while the benefits of utilising e-business strategies and internet-based technologies are numerous, so are the inherent risks, creating exposures that were unheard of a decade ago.
These include:

  • Theft or manipulation of sensitive or private information, such as financial or health records
  • Virulent computer viruses that can destroy data, damage hardware, cripple systems and disrupt a business' operations
  • Computer fraud

Unfortunately, internet and network exposures are increasingly subject to exclusion from "traditional" insurance policies since commercial general liability and property policies were originally designed to respond to liabilities and natural perils that damage physical assets. With internet-based technologies, "i-exposures" are largely intangible, the result of human error, or deliberate malicious attacks and crimes.

Marsh works with leading cyber risk insurers to develop cyber risk insurance protection for internet and network exposures, including:

  • Liability: privacy and confidentiality
  • Copyright, trademark, defamation
  • Malicious code and viruses
  • Business interruption: network outages, computer failures
  • Attacks, unauthorised access, theft, website defacement and cyber extortion
  • Technology errors & omissions
  • Intellectual property infringement

What is cyber privacy issues? ›

This privacy extends to the systems that collect, store, process and transmit data. Cyber privacy can include both personally identifying information (PII) or non-identifying information which when aggregated can be used to identify - like a user's behavior on a website and cookie information.

What is security and privacy risk? ›

Privacy is the right to control how your information is viewed and used, while security is protection against threats or danger. In the digital world, security generally refers to the unauthorized access of data, often involving protection against hackers or cyber criminals.

What is risk impact in cyber security? ›

Cybersecurity risks relate to the loss of confidentiality, integrity, or availability of information, data, or information (or control) systems and reflect the potential adverse impacts to organizational operations (i.e., mission, functions, image, or reputation) and assets, individuals, other organizations, and the ...
